Forbes today released its 2012 ranking of America's Richest Top 400
Billionaires and Bill Gates remains the nation’s richest man for the
19th time yearly. Checkout the Top 10 Below:-










1. Bill Gates, Medina, Wash, $66 billion


2. Warren Buffett, Omaha, $46 billion


3. Larry Ellison, Woodside, Calif, $41 billion


4. Charles Koch, Wichita, Kan, $31 billion


5. David Koch, New York City, $31 billion


6. Christy Walton & family, Jackson, Wyo, $27.9 billion


7. Jim Walton, Bentonville, Ark, $26.8 billion


8. Alice Walton, Fort Worth, Texas, $26.3 billion


9. S. Robson Walton, Bentonville, Ark, $26.1 billion


10. Michael Bloomberg, New York City, $25 billion




Facebook C.E.O Mark Zuckerberg was the biggest Loser this Year. Zuckerberg dropped from No. 14 on the list to No. 36.
